Final “Self-Assessment Reflection”
Ministry of Education in BC
-all students in BC required to do the reflections
-Canadian education- teaching students to be independent
learners
-set goals for ourselves
- not rely on teacher for everything
-self-motivated - internal motivation to learn
-self-directed – set your own goals, figure out what steps
you have to take to achieve those goals
-
student must be an active learner, not passive
“Self-Assessment Reflection”
-tool to promote self-motivation and self-direction
In my opinion, goal setting is critical to learning skills.

Final marks
My advice: If your mark is less than 60%, you should not go
to the next level.
The pass mark in BC is 50%.
If you go to the next level with mostly Developing skills,
with a few Proficient skills, you will be lost in the higher level class.
If your mark is a solid 60% or higher, you will likely be ok
in a higher level.
The other thing to improve is a balance between written
skills and spoken skills.
